Abstract

A geometric approach to analyze solar cells with local rear contacts has been proposed in a recent paper. This brief presents an extension to it based on numerical iteration that permits us to determine I -V characteristic curves and conversion efficiencies. A good agreement with 3-D Sentaurus Device simulations is observed.
